25.01.2026 15:28 β π 10 π 1 π¬ 1 π 0Icon array of Bollywood film covers, ordered by year from 1990 to 2024. The movie covers are color-coded by genre. The romance genre was quite popular, along with the action genre, at the beginning. Since 2015, the romance genre has become less prevalent, while the action genre has become more so. The fantasy genre is also prominent. Published by Kontinentalist.
